Description

Automatic chamfering machine capable of simultaneously chamfering two ends
Technical Field
The utility model relates to a technical field of car aluminium alloy chamfer equipment especially relates to an automatic chamfer machine simultaneously at two.
Background
In the prior art, the aluminum pipe is chamfered through a manual instrument lathe, and only one end can be machined at each time, so that when the second end of the aluminum pipe is chamfered, the chamfering radian or the depth or the shallow condition exists, the chamfering radians at the two ends of the same aluminum pipe are inconsistent, and the aluminum pipe is unqualified.
Disclosure of Invention
Aiming at the problem that the radian of chamfers at two ends of the same aluminum type pipe is inconsistent in the existing manual instrument lathe, the automatic chamfering machine for two ends simultaneously ensures that the radians of chamfers at two ends of the same aluminum type pipe are consistent, improves the processing efficiency and saves the cost.
The specific technical scheme is as follows:
an automatic double-end simultaneous chamfering machine, comprising: a base;
the two installation seats are symmetrically arranged at two ends of the base, the upper end of each installation seat is provided with an installation groove, the surface of each installation groove is arranged in an arc shape, and the two installation grooves are used for placing two ends of an aluminum type pipe;
the two chamfering machines are symmetrically arranged at the end parts of the two ends of the base, and the movable ends of the two chamfering machines are respectively opposite to the two ends of the aluminum type pipe;
the lower ends of the two rotating rods are respectively and rotatably connected with the base, and the two rotating rods are respectively opposite to the two mounting seats;
the two ends of the handle bar are fixedly connected with the upper ends of the two rotating rods respectively;
the two pressing seats are respectively and fixedly connected with the two rotating rods, the two pressing seats are respectively opposite to the two mounting seats, the lower end surfaces of the two pressing seats are arranged in an arc shape, and the two pressing seats are used for tightly pressing two ends of the aluminum type pipe.
The automatic chamfering machine with two ends simultaneously is characterized in that a limiting block is arranged on the base and located between the mounting seat and the corresponding chamfering machine, a through hole is formed in the limiting block and is used for allowing one end of the aluminum-shaped pipe to penetrate through, and the limiting block is matched with the aluminum-shaped pipe in a radial limiting mode.
The automatic chamfering machine with two ends simultaneously comprises a base, a rotating rod, a torsion spring, a pressing seat and a mounting seat, wherein the lower end of the rotating rod is rotatably connected with the base through a pin shaft, the pin shaft is sleeved with the torsion spring, and the torsion spring is used for driving the pressing seat to be far away from the mounting seat corresponding to the pressing seat.
In the automatic chamfering machine with two ends at the same time, two sides of the lower end of the pressing seat respectively abut against two sides of the upper end of the mounting groove of the corresponding mounting seat.
In the automatic chamfering machine for both ends, rubber pads are respectively attached to the upper ends of the two mounting seats, and the aluminum-type pipe is clamped between the pressing seat and the rubber pads.
The base comprises a first base, a second base and a third base, the mounting seat and the rotating rod are arranged on the first base, the second base and the third base are located at two ends of the first base, the chamfering machines are respectively arranged on the second base and the third base, and the upper side faces of the first base, the second base and the third base are flush with each other.
The automatic chamfering machine for both ends simultaneously comprises: the first base, the second base and the third base are arranged on the platform.
In the automatic chamfering machine with two ends simultaneously, the width of the mounting seat is greater than that of the pressing seat.
In the automatic chamfering machine with two ends, a controller is arranged on the platform and is electrically connected with the two chamfering machines respectively.
In the automatic chamfering machine with two ends simultaneously, the platform is provided with the driving mechanism, the driving mechanism is electrically connected with the controller, and the driving mechanism is respectively in transmission connection with the two rotating rods and used for driving the pressing seat to press the aluminum-shaped pipe in the mounting seat.
Compared with the prior art, the technical scheme has the positive effects that:
(1) the utility model discloses set up two bevelers, carry out the chamfer to the both ends of aluminium type tubular product simultaneously, can guarantee that the radian of the chamfer at the both ends of same aluminium type tubular product is unanimous, improved machining efficiency, save the cost.
(2) The utility model discloses set the surface of mounting groove to the arc, set the lower terminal surface of pressing the seat to the arc to and the width of cooperation mount pad is greater than the width of pressing the seat, can guarantee at the stability of chamfer in-process aluminium type tubular product, prevent that aluminium type tubular product from taking place the skew.
(3) The utility model discloses set up a stopper, through-hole clearance fit in aluminium type tubular product and the stopper, the through-hole of stopper and the radial spacing cooperation of aluminium type tubular product further prevent that aluminium type tubular product from taking place the skew.

Detailed Description
The present invention will be further described with reference to the accompanying drawings and specific embodiments, but the present invention is not limited thereto.
Fig. 1 is the utility model relates to an overall structure cross-sectional view of automatic two-end while beveler, fig. 2 is the utility model relates to an automatic two-end while beveler's main view, as shown in fig. 1 and fig. 2, the automatic two-end while beveler of a preferred embodiment is shown, include: a base 1, two mount pads 2, two beveler 3 and two pressure seats 4, the both ends of base 1 are located to two mount pad 2 symmetries, the upper end of each mount pad 2 all is equipped with mounting groove 5, the surface of mounting groove 5 is the arc setting, two mounting grooves 5 are used for placing the both ends of aluminium type tubular product 6, the tip at the both ends of base 1 is located to two beveler 3 symmetries, the expansion end of two beveler 3 is just right with the both ends of aluminium type tubular product 6 respectively, two pressure seats 4 are just right with two mount pads 2 respectively, the arc setting is personally submitted to the lower extreme of two pressure seats 4, two pressure seats 4 are used for compressing tightly the both ends of aluminium type tubular product 6. Preferably, the arc-shaped mounting groove 5 is matched with the lower end face of the arc-shaped pressing seat 4, so that the stability of the aluminum-shaped pipe 6 on the mounting seat 2 can be ensured.
Further, as a preferred embodiment, the automatic double-end simultaneous chamfering machine further includes: two rotating rods 7, the lower ends of the two rotating rods 7 are respectively connected with the base 1 in a rotating way, and the two rotating rods 7 are respectively opposite to the two mounting seats 2.
Further, as a preferred embodiment, the automatic double-end simultaneous chamfering machine further includes: and two ends of the handle bar 8 are respectively fixedly connected with the upper ends of the two rotating rods 7.
Further, as a preferred embodiment, the two pressing bases 4 are fixedly connected to the two rotating rods 7, respectively. Preferably, the pressure base 4 is fixedly connected with the rotating rod 7 through a connecting rod 18.
Further, as an embodiment of a preferred embodiment, a limiting block 9 is arranged on the base 1, the limiting block 9 is located between one of the mounting seats 2 and the corresponding chamfering machine 3, a through hole is formed in the limiting block 9, one end of the aluminum-shaped pipe 6 penetrates through the through hole, and the limiting block 9 is in radial limiting fit with the aluminum-shaped pipe 6.
Further, as a preferred embodiment, the lower end of the rotating rod 7 is rotatably connected with the base 1 through a pin shaft 10, a torsion spring 11 is sleeved on the pin shaft 10, and the torsion spring 11 is used for driving the pressing seat 4 to be away from the corresponding mounting seat 2. Preferably, the torsion spring 11 is provided to provide the handle bar 8 with upward restoring force, and when the handle bar 8 is loosened, the handle bar 8 can be automatically sprung, so that the operation efficiency is improved, and time and labor are saved.
The above is merely an example of the preferred embodiments of the present invention, and the embodiments and the protection scope of the present invention are not limited thereby.
The utility model discloses still have following embodiment on above-mentioned basis:
in a further embodiment of the present invention, please continue to refer to fig. 1 and fig. 2, two sides of the lower end of the pressing seat 4 respectively abut against two sides of the upper end of the mounting groove 5 corresponding to the mounting seat 2. Preferably, the stability of the pressure seat 4 is ensured, preventing the pressure seat 4 from shaking.
In the embodiment of the present invention, the upper ends of the two mounting seats 2 are respectively covered with a rubber pad 12, and the aluminum-type pipe 6 is clamped between the pressing seat and the rubber pad 12. Preferably, an accommodating space is formed between the lower end of the pressing seat 4 and the corresponding mounting seat 2, the aluminum-type tube 6 is clamped between the pressing seat 4 and the mounting seat 2, and the rubber pad 12 can protect the aluminum-type tube 6 from being scratched and increase the stability of the aluminum-type tube 6.
The utility model discloses a further embodiment, base 1 includes first base 13, second base 14 and third base 15, and mount pad 2 and bull stick 7 are located on first base 13, and second base 14 and third base 15 are located the both ends of first base 13, and two beveler 3 are located respectively on second base 14 and third base 15, and the last side of first base 13, second base 14 and third base 15 flushes mutually.
The utility model discloses a in the further embodiment, automatic both ends chamfer machine simultaneously still includes: the platform 17, the first base 13, the second base 14 and the third base 15 are provided on the platform 17.
In a further embodiment of the present invention, the width of the mounting seat 2 is greater than the width of the pressing seat 4. Preferably, the stability of the pressure seat 4 is further increased, preventing the pressure seat 4 from tilting.
In a further embodiment of the present invention, a controller 16 is disposed on the platform 17, and the controller 16 is electrically connected to the two chamfering machines 3.
The utility model discloses a further embodiment is equipped with actuating mechanism (not shown in the figure) on the platform 17, and actuating mechanism is connected with 16 electricity connections of controller, and actuating mechanism is connected with two bull stick 7 transmissions respectively for order about and press seat 4 to compress tightly aluminium type tubular product 6 in the mount pad 2. Preferably, the driving mechanism may be a rocker mechanism, and the rocker mechanism controls the rotating rod 7 to rotate, so as to drive the pressing base 4 to press the aluminum type pipe 6.
The utility model discloses can also make through 16 control actuating mechanism of controller and press 4 activities of seat through staff manual operation, improve machining efficiency, and can be according to particular case and decide.
The utility model discloses set up two beveler 3, carry out the chamfer to the both ends of aluminium type tubular product 6 simultaneously, can guarantee that the radian of the chamfer at the both ends of same aluminium type tubular product 6 is unanimous, improved machining efficiency, save the cost.
The utility model discloses set the surface of mounting groove 5 to the arc, set the lower terminal surface of pressing seat 4 to the arc to and the width of cooperation mount pad 2 is greater than the width of pressing seat 4, can guarantee at the stability of chamfer in-process aluminium type tubular product 6, prevents that aluminium type tubular product 6 from taking place the skew.
The utility model discloses set up a stopper 9, through-hole clearance fit in aluminium type tubular product 6 and the stopper 9, stopper 9's through-hole and the radial spacing cooperation of aluminium type tubular product 6 further prevent that aluminium type tubular product 6 from taking place the skew.
